Wow. Science, the ultra-prestigious journal, has released a special public issue on the top 125 questions in science -- in honor of their 125th anniversary. They highlight 25 of those, including one of my favorite topics -- the question of human solitude. Alas, they don't explore the Fermi Paradox at all.
